Affordable college with great learning environment and placements.

Faculty: Teachers are well qualified and helpful, at least better than what I have heard about other colleges. Curriculum is updated and industry-oriented. The best thing here I like is workshops, where we get to know so many new things. Exams are moderate, but the checking is a bit strict, passing percentage is around 80% I guess, not sure. The attendance factor is also here, with a minimum 75% to be maintained, but teachers can give a relaxation of 10% for valid reasons.

College infrastructure and facility.

Faculty: Teachers are very good in nature. They support every student. Mostly teacher has doctorate. More than 70 teachers are Ph.D. holders. Mostly teachers have good teaching experience. They have more than 10-20 years of experience, and some teachers are government retire officers. Exam is not very difficult because most topics are already covered by the teacher.

This college is good for studies and getting a raw experience of the real industry life.

Faculty: Faculty members are supportive, well-qualified, and knowledgeable. They make concepts easy to understand. The curriculum is relevant, covering programming, data science, and analytics, but students need extra self-learning for advanced industry skills. Semester exams are of moderate difficulty, and with regular study, most students clear them easily. The pass percentage is around 85-90%.
